Trump removes US attorney general Pam Bondi from office

Attorney General Pam Bondi is leaving her position, President Donald Trump announced Thursday.

Axar.az reports, citing NBC, in a post on Truth Social, President Trump wrote: "We love Pam, and she will be transitioning to a much needed and important new job in the private sector, to be announced at a date in the near future."

He added that Deputy Attorney General Todd Blanche would take over as the acting attorney general.

Trump had grown “more and more frustrated” with Bondi in recent days, a person familiar with White House deliberations said, adding that while he likes her as a person, he doesn’t think she has “executed on his vision” in the way that he wants.

Bondi is the second Cabinet member axed by the president Trump, following the firing of Homeland Security Secretary Kristi Noem last month in a similar downfall.
